Finding the Best Ophthalmic & Optometric Support Services School for You
Ophthalmic & Optometric Support Services is the #45 most popular major in the country with 817 degrees and certificates awarded in 2021-2022.

Optometric Support Concentrations
| Major |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Opticianry/Ophthalmic Dispensing Optician | 445 |
| Ophthalmic Technician/Technologist | 196 |
| Optometric Technician/Assistant | 154 |
| Other Ophthalmic and Optometric Support Services and Allied Professions | 22 |
